Output ca53b93a3e88679953edd4c928b6aefc5d4d2ca7e58fa7a921679e3bc36e147a:1

value
20926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f708ac43609121b75dcb6798660c1532d0b7af18 OP_EQUAL
address
3QDDDXgJ4W1KhzfpYZJ6KFU3ShuNTfYi7B
transaction
ca53b93a3e88679953edd4c928b6aefc5d4d2ca7e58fa7a921679e3bc36e147a
confirmations
172
spent
true